Buyers Guide: How To Pick The Best Laptop For Tattoo Artist?

We will break it down into a few things you must consider before purchasing the best laptop for tattoo artists.

Processor

The CPU is the brain of your laptop. It can be one of the most important factors in your decision-making process. Because, it decides how well your machine will handle different tasks like video rendering or the recreation of visual art on screen.

Intel Core I5 or I7 CPUs are very useful for tattoo artists. Because they’re not only capable of handling everything you throw at them, but they’re also less expensive than AMD models with similar power levels.

Ram

RAM is used to store temporary files, programs, swatches, etc., for fast access when you’re working on them. So the additional memory you have, your machine will slow down less frequently.

An 8 GB of DDR3 RAM, equivalent to 2400Mhz speed, is standard in most tattooing laptops today. However, 16GB or 32GB are recommended if you deal with large photo/video editing projects.

Display

Your screen resolution or display size will affect your drawing work to a certain extent. i.e., Smaller screens offer less space for larger art pieces. In contrast, larger displays can fit larger images without one pixel looking smaller than another, so if you’re dealing with something small like business logos, you need not worry about the screen size much.

Still, if you deal with regular photo editing work, 15.6″ is probably all you’d ever need to meet your requirements. Anything bigger than this will only make your system heavier.
